VPS Hardening

Security auditing and automated hardening for remote servers.

Commands

/harden audit <host>

Run security audit against a server. Checks:

  • System updates
  • Auto-updates configuration
  • SSH root login status
  • Password authentication
  • Firewall status
  • Fail2ban status
  • System uptime
  • Listening services
  • Sudo user configuration

/harden fix <host>

Apply safe fixes that won't lock you out:

  • Install system updates
  • Enable unattended-upgrades
  • Configure UFW firewall
  • Install and enable fail2ban
  • Set SSH MaxAuthTries

/harden emergency <host>

Quick 10-minute hardening for new servers:

  • Full system update
  • Firewall setup
  • Fail2ban installation
  • Root password lock

/harden report <host>

Generate markdown security report.

Security Checks

Check Pass Criteria
System Updates 0 pending updates
Auto Updates unattended-upgrades installed
Root Login PermitRootLogin no
Password Auth PasswordAuthentication no
Firewall UFW active or iptables configured
Fail2ban Service running
Uptime < 90 days
Services < 10 listening ports
Sudo Users At least one non-root sudo user
MaxAuthTries Set to 3 or less
